summaryrefslogtreecommitdiff
Commit message (Collapse)AuthorAge
...
| * | | | | | | | Fix a spec conformance issue when parsing a ns voteSebastian Hahn2009-09-14
| | |_|_|_|/ / / | |/|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| A vote may only contain exactly one signature. Make sure we reject votes that violate this. Problem found by Rotor, who also helped writing the patch. Thanks!
* | | | | | | | Merge commit 'sebastian/manpage'Roger Dingledine2009-09-16
|\ \ \ \ \ \ \ \ | |_|_|_|/ / / / |/| | | | | | |
| * | | | | | | it is cached-descriptors now, not cached-routersSebastian Hahn2009-09-15
| | | | | | | |
* | | | | | | | Merge branch 'tmp'Roger Dingledine2009-09-16
|\ \ \ \ \ \ \ \
| * | | | | | | | minor fixes in some commentsRoger Dingledine2009-09-06
| | |/ / / / / / | |/| | | | | |
* | | | | | | | Merge commit 'origin/maint-0.2.1'Nick Mathewson2009-09-15
|\ \ \ \ \ \ \ \ | | |_|_|/ / / / | |/| | | | | | | | | | | | | | | | | | | | | | Resolved conflicts in: src/or/circuitbuild.c
| * | | | | | | Merge commit 'sebastian/memleak' into maint-0.2.1Nick Mathewson2009-09-15
| |\ \ \ \ \ \ \
| | * | | | | | | Fix a memory leak when parsing a nsSebastian Hahn2009-09-14
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Adding the same vote to a networkstatus consensus leads to a memory leak on the client side. Fix that by only using the first vote from any given voter, and ignoring the others. Problem found by Rotor, who also helped writing the patch. Thanks!
| * | | | | | | | make some bug 1090 warnings go awaySebastian Hahn2009-09-16
| |/ / / / / /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When we excluded some Exits, we were sometimes warning the user that we were going to use the node regardless. Many of those warnings were in fact bogus, because the relay in question was not used to connect to the outside world. Based on patch by Rotor, thanks!
* | | | | | | | Merge commit 'origin/maint-0.2.1'Nick Mathewson2009-09-15
|\ \ \ \ \ \ \ \ | |/ / / / / / /
| * | | | | | | Fix obscure 64-bit big-endian hidserv bugRoger Dingledine2009-09-02
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Fix an obscure bug where hidden services on 64-bit big-endian systems might mis-read the timestamp in v3 introduce cells, and refuse to connect back to the client. Discovered by "rotor". Bugfix on 0.2.1.6-alpha.
* | | | | | | | Fix compile on Snow LeopardSebastian Hahn2009-09-15
| | | | | | | |
* | | | | | | | some cleanups:Sebastian Hahn2009-09-15
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| documentation fix for get_uint64 remove extra "." from a log line fix a long line
* | | | | | | | revert the month in the man page, so we don't drive weasel madRoger Dingledine2009-09-15
| | | | | | | |
* | | | | | | | Forward port patches/06_add_compile_time_defaults.dpatchPeter Palfrader2009-09-15
| | | | | | | |
* | | | | | | | Forward port patches/03_tor_manpage_in_section_8.dpatchPeter Palfrader2009-09-15
| | | | | | | |
* | | | | | | | New upstream versionPeter Palfrader2009-09-15
| | | | | | | |
* | | | | | | | Read "circwindow=x" from the consensus and use itRoger Dingledine2009-09-15
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Tor now reads the "circwindow" parameter out of the consensus, and uses that value for its circuit package window rather than the default of 1000 cells. Begins the implementation of proposal 168.
* | | | | | | | ConsensusParams config option lists key=value paramsRoger Dingledine2009-09-15
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| finishes the authority-operator interface side of proposal 167.
* | | | | | | | Parameter access function, with unit tests.Nick Mathewson2009-09-14
| | | | | | | |
* | | | | | | | Mark proposal 167 as implemented.Nick Mathewson2009-09-14
| | | | | | | |
* | | | | | | | Implement proposal 167: Authorities vote on network parameters.Nick Mathewson2009-09-14
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This code adds a new field to vote on: "params". It consists of a list of sorted key=int pairs. The output is computed as the median of all the integers for any key on which anybody voted. Improved with input from Roger.
* | | | | | | | Add a median_int32 and find_nth_int32Nick Mathewson2009-09-14
| |/ / / / / / |/| | | | | |
* | | | | | | i couldn't break nick's tor_parse_double()Roger Dingledine2009-09-02
| | | | | | | | | | | | | | | | | | | | | | | | | | | | i guess that means i should call them unit tests and check them in.
* | | | | | | spelling, indenting, punctuatingRoger Dingledine2009-09-01
| | | | | | |
* | | | | | | move the packaging change list to 0.2.2.1-alphaRoger Dingledine2009-09-01
| | | | | | |
* | | | | | | Merge branch 'maint-0.2.1'Roger Dingledine2009-09-01
|\ \ \ \ \ \ \ | |/ / / / / / | | / / / / / | |/ / / / / |/| | | | |
| * | | | | turns out the packaging changes aren't in 0.2.1.20Roger Dingledine2009-09-01
| | | | | |
* | | | | | Fix compile warnings on Snow LeopardSebastian Hahn2009-09-01
| | | | | | | | | | | | | | | | | | | | | | | | Big thanks to nickm and arma for helping me with this!
* | | | | | Merge commit 'origin/maint-0.2.1'Nick Mathewson2009-09-01
|\ \ \ \ \ \ | |/ / / / /
| * | | | | update changelog with bundle detailsAndrew Lewman2009-09-01
| | | | | |
* | | | | | Merge commit 'origin/maint-0.2.1'Nick Mathewson2009-09-01
|\ \ \ \ \ \ | |/ / / / /
| * | | | | Use an _actual_ fix for the byte-reverse warning.Nick Mathewson2009-09-01
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| (Given that we're pretty much assuming that int is 32 bits, and given that hex values are always unsigned, taking out the "ul" from 0xff000000 should be fine.)
| * | | | | Use a simpler fix for the byte-reversing warningNick Mathewson2009-09-01
| | | | | |
| * | | | | Fix compile warnings on Snow LeopardSebastian Hahn2009-09-01
| |/ / / / | | | | | | | | | | | | | | | Big thanks to nickm and arma for helping me with this!
| * | | | Add getinfo accepted-server-descriptor. Clean spec.Roger Dingledine2009-08-31
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Add a "getinfo status/accepted-server-descriptor" controller command, which is the recommended way for controllers to learn whether our server descriptor has been successfully received by at least on directory authority. Un-recommend good-server-descriptor getinfo and status events until we have a better design for them.
* | | | | Remove a debug printfSebastian Hahn2009-09-01
| | | | |
* | | | | typoSebastian Hahn2009-09-01
| | | | |
* | | | | Merge commit 'public/bug1076'Nick Mathewson2009-09-01
|\ \ \ \ \
| * | | | | Revise parsing of time and memory units to handle spaces.Nick Mathewson2009-08-31
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| When we added support for fractional units (like 1.5 MB) I broke support for giving units with no space (like 2MB). This patch should fix that. It also adds a propoer tor_parse_double(). Fix for bug 1076. Bugfix on 0.2.2.1-alpha.
* | | | | | Merge branch 'maint-0.2.1'Roger Dingledine2009-08-31
|\ \ \ \ \ \ | |/ / / / / |/| / / / / | |/ / / /
| * | | | Only send reachability status events on overall success/failureRoger Dingledine2009-08-31
| |/ / / |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| We were telling the controller about CHECKING_REACHABILITY and REACHABILITY_FAILED status events whenever we launch a testing circuit or notice that one has failed. Instead, only tell the controller when we want to inform the user of overall success or overall failure. Bugfix on 0.1.2.6-alpha. Fixes bug 1075. Reported by SwissTorExit.
* | | | Merge branch 'maint-0.2.1'Roger Dingledine2009-08-28
|\ \ \ \ | |/ / /
| * | | Only send netinfo clock_skew to controller if an authority told us soRoger Dingledine2009-08-28
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| We were triggering a CLOCK_SKEW controller status event whenever we connect via the v2 connection protocol to any relay that has a wrong clock. Instead, we should only inform the controller when it's a trusted authority that claims our clock is wrong. Bugfix on 0.2.0.20-rc; starts to fix bug 1074. Reported by SwissTorExit.
* | | | bump to 0.2.2.1-alpha-devRoger Dingledine2009-08-27
| | | |
* | | | start changelog for 0.2.2.2-alphaRoger Dingledine2009-08-27
| | | |
* | | | Merge branch 'maint-0.2.1'Roger Dingledine2009-08-27
|\ \ \ \ | |/ / /
| * | | extremely infinite? who talks like that?Roger Dingledine2009-08-27
| | | |
* | | | Merge branch 'maint-0.2.1'Roger Dingledine2009-08-27
|\ \ \ \ | |/ / / | | | / | |_|/ |/| |
| * | nobody forward-ported the 0.2.0.35 changelogRoger Dingledine2009-08-26
| | |